Which statement best identifies John F. Kennedy's argument in his speech at Rice University?

    "We choose to go to the moon" is the statement that best identifies John. F. Kennedy's argument in his speech at Rice University.

    Explanation:

    On September 12, 1962 John. F. Kennedy delivers his iconic speech at the Rice University with rhetoric speech and romantic notion motivating the audience to reach out to the moon.

    A powerful oratory for massive accomplishments towards space goals. "We choose to go to the moon" is the statement that best identifies John. F. Kennedy's argument in his speech at Rice University.

    It intensifies the audience to have an motivation towards the need to succeed in reaching the moon.
